Аннотация
Обзор литературы посвящен вопросам выбора тактики лечения больных с аортальным стенозом. Представлены основные методы хирургической коррекции данного состояния. Обоснована эффективность транскатетерной имплантации аортального клапана. Проанализированы результаты исследований, сравнивающих исходы хирургической и эндоваскулярной коррекции аортального стеноза. Особое внимание уделено выбору метода лечения у пациентов с аортальным стенозом и коронарным шунтированием в анамнезе. Сделано заключение о перспективности транскатетерной имплантации аортального клапана в этой когорте больных.
